Safety guidelines issued for barbershop customers

MUSCAT: Muscat Municipality has issued a new set of health and safety guidelines for customers visiting barbershops across the governorate, aiming to ensure a secure and comfortable environment for both patrons and staff.

The official advisory urges residents to book their appointments in advance to minimize crowding and reduce waiting times inside the salons. Upon entering the premises, customers are expected to wash their hands to protect public health and maintain strict hygiene standards. To further enhance safety, the municipality strongly recommends that customers bring their own personal grooming tools whenever possible, strictly warning against the sharing of personal items such as towels and shaving equipment.

Additionally, the health directives advise patrons to inform barbers of any skin allergies prior to the application of any creams or grooming products. Officials also emphasized the importance of maintaining calm and orderly conduct inside the shops to ensure a comfortable and professional experience for everyone present.
